How to Prepare for Spring Youth Turkey Season
We're heading into spring here in Ohio, and that means that spring turkey season is right around the corner. This year, youth turkey season will fall on Saturday, April 21 and Sunday, April 22. This is immediately before the regular turkey hunting season and gives a chance for the littlest hunters to get in on the action. Hunting hours are from 30 minutes before sunrise until sunset. Here's what you need to know to have a great time hunting with your kids while also keeping everyone as safe as possible.
Comply with All Regulations
Hunting practices are strictly regulated in Ohio, so you want to make sure that you and your kids are following the rules. You'll each need to have a valid hunting license and a wild turkey permit to be allowed to participate in youth turkey season. During the hunting period, each youth hunter can bag no more than two wild turkeys, one per day. If you plan to take your kids out hunting during the regular turkey season as well, keep in mind that this two-turkey limit applies for the entire season. If your child bags two birds during youth season, that's it for the rest of the year.
Teach Proper Gun Safety
Here at Norton Sporting Goods, gun safety is our top priority, especially when it comes to youth hunters. Take the time to educate your kids about gun safety before you head out to hunt. Once you're out there, they'll likely be too excited to pay attention, so pick a time when they are calm and focused. Make sure that your children know how to load, unload and clean their firearms, and stress the importance of never pointing a gun at another person, even if it isn't loaded.
While out on the hunt, wear reflective or brightly colored clothing so that other hunters can clearly see you, and remind your kids frequently of the safety tips you have taught them. If you notice that they seem to be getting a bit over-excited, take a break to cool down. When kids get rambunctious, all those safety precautions can slip their minds, so take care to keep them focused on the task at hand.
